THE ROSE, by                 Poet Analysis     Poet's Biography
First Line: Before mans fall, the rose was born
Last Line: But ne're the rose without the thorn.
Subject(s): Flowers; Roses


Before Mans fall, the Rose was born
(S. Ambrose sayes) without the Thorn:
But, for Mans fault, then was the Thorn,
Without the fragrant Rose-bud, born;
But ne're the Rose without the Thorn.
